About agriculture in Bilalang
Bilalang is situated in the North Sulawesi province of Indonesia, nestled within the lush, mountainous landscape that characterizes the region. The surrounding rural area is defined by rolling hills, dense tropical vegetation, and a climate that supports year-round agricultural activity, with fertile volcanic soil providing an excellent foundation for diverse farming.
Agricultural production in this area primarily focuses on subsistence and smallholder cash crops. Farmers here traditionally cultivate staple food crops such as rice and maize, alongside essential regional commodities including coconut, cloves, and various fruits. Small-scale livestock farming, particularly poultry and goats, is commonly integrated into the local farm operations to support household needs.
